Когда необходимо вставить много строк в таблицу сразу, это может оказаться довольно утомительной задачей. Однако, существуют несколько способов, которые позволяют справиться с этой задачей в кратчайшие сроки.
Во-первых, можно воспользоваться функцией-генератором, которая создает нужное количество строк таблицы. Для этого можно использовать язык программирования Python и библиотеку Pandas. Преимущество такого подхода заключается в возможности автоматизировать процесс и создать таблицу с необходимым количеством строк всего за несколько строк кода.
Во-вторых, можно воспользоваться уже существующими инструментами для работы с таблицами, такими как Microsoft Excel или Google Sheets. В этих приложениях существуют специальные команды и функции, которые позволяют быстро вставить много строк в таблицу. Например, в Excel можно использовать команду «Вставить строки», чтобы добавить несколько пустых строк в нужное место таблицы.
В-третьих, если у вас есть доступ к базе данных и вы знакомы с языком SQL, вы можете использовать команду INSERT для вставки нескольких строк в таблицу. Этот метод может быть полезен, если у вас уже есть данные, которые необходимо вставить, и вы хотите сразу добавить их в таблицу.
Простой способ добавить несколько строк в таблицу
Когда у вас есть много строк данных для добавления в таблицу, иногда может быть утомительно и ресурсоемко вставлять каждую строку по отдельности. Но есть способ добавить много строк сразу в таблицу, сэкономив время и усилия.
Для вставки множества строк в таблицу можно воспользоваться тегами ul и li. Данный метод основан на использовании списка с маркерами для создания каждой строки таблицы в виде элемента списка. В результате получается структурированный и понятный код.
Процесс добавления множества строк начинается с объявления таблицы с помощью тега table. Затем, при помощи тега ul, создается список с маркером для каждой строки таблицы. Каждая строка представляется отдельным элементом списка, создаваемом при помощи тега li.
Для добавления данных внутри каждой строки таблицы можно использовать различные теги — например, p, strong, em и другие.
<table>
<ul>
<li>...</li>
<li>...</li>
<li>...</li>
</ul>
</table>
После добавления всех необходимых строк в списке, закрываются теги ul и table. Полученный код можно легко изменять и дополнять новыми строками при необходимости.
Таким образом, использование списка с маркерами и элемента списка для каждой строки таблицы является простым и эффективным способом добавить много строк в таблицу одновременно.
Использовать цикл для автоматического создания строк
Когда нужно вставить несколько строк в таблицу одновременно, можно воспользоваться циклом, чтобы автоматически создать нужное количество строк.
Такой подход позволяет сразу вставить необходимое количество строк в таблицу, без необходимости повторять одну и ту же операцию вручную. Кроме того, он позволяет делать эти действия быстро и эффективно.
Для этого необходимо использовать цикл, такой как for или while, чтобы повторять операцию вставки строки определенное количество раз.
Пример использования цикла для автоматического создания строк в таблице:
- Создайте таблицу с нужным количеством столбцов. Например, используя теги <table> и <tr>.
- Создайте заголовок таблицы, используя тег <thead> и тег <th>. Задайте заголовки для каждого столбца таблицы.
- Создайте тело таблицы, используя тег <tbody> и тег <td>. Задайте содержимое для каждого столбца таблицы.
- Используйте цикл, чтобы повторить операцию вставки строки нужное количество раз.
- Определите, сколько раз нужно повторить операцию вставки строки. Например, используя переменную.
- Используйте цикл for или while для повторения операции вставки строки заданное количество раз.
- Внутри цикла, используйте команду вставки строки в таблицу.</li>
- Проверьте результат и убедитесь, что в таблице добавлены нужные строки.
Этот метод позволяет легко и быстро добавить необходимое количество строк в таблицу. Используя цикл, можно автоматизировать этот процесс и сэкономить время и силы, которые могут быть потрачены на ручное добавление каждой строки.
Примечание: При использовании данного метода следует быть внимательным, чтобы не создать слишком количество строк, которые могут снизить производительность таблицы или вызвать проблемы с отображением информации.
Скопировать и вставить существующие строки
Когда вам нужно добавить много строк в таблицу, можно воспользоваться методом копирования и вставки уже существующих строк. Это позволяет быстро создать несколько строк с данными, избегая ручного ввода каждой строки отдельно. Используя сочетание клавиш и мыши, вы можете сразу вставить много строк в таблицу.
Для того чтобы скопировать и вставить существующие строки, выполните следующие шаги:
- Выделите строку или строки, которые вы хотите скопировать. Для выделения нескольких строк удерживайте клавишу Shift и щелкните на первой и последней строке, либо удерживайте клавишу Ctrl и щелкайте на каждой нужной строке по отдельности.
- Скопируйте выделенные строки, нажав комбинацию клавиш Ctrl+C или используя контекстное меню и выбрав «Копировать».
- Установите курсор в позицию, где вы хотите вставить скопированные строки.
- Вставьте скопированные строки, нажав комбинацию клавиш Ctrl+V или используя контекстное меню и выбрав «Вставить».
Повторяйте эти шаги для каждой группы строк, которые вы хотите добавить в таблицу. Можно копировать и вставлять сколько угодно строк одновременно, что позволяет осуществить быстрое добавление большого количества данных в таблицу.
Эффективный способ вставить много строк в таблицу одновременно
Когда вам нужно добавить сразу много строк в таблицу, существует несколько эффективных способов выполнить эту задачу. Вместо того, чтобы добавлять строки по одной, можно использовать специальные инструменты и подходы, которые позволяют вставить все строки одновременно.
Использование тегов <ul> и <li>
Один из способов вставки множества строк в таблицу — это использование тегов <ul> и <li>. Первым шагом нужно создать список <ul> внутри таблицы, а затем использовать тег <li> для каждой строки таблицы. Вставка всех строк происходит одновременно, что значительно упрощает процесс.
<table>
<tbody>
<ul>
<li>Первая строка</li>
<li>Вторая строка</li>
<li>Третья строка</li>
<li>...</li>
</ul>
</tbody>
</table>
Использование тегов <ol> и <li>
Еще один способ вставки множества строк — это использование тегов <ol> и <li>. Как и в предыдущем примере, нужно создать список с помощью тега <ol>, а затем использовать тег <li> для каждой строки таблицы.
<table>
<tbody>
<ol>
<li>Первая строка</li>
<li>Вторая строка</li>
<li>Третья строка</li>
<li>...</li>
</ol>
</tbody>
</table>
Использование JavaScript
Если у вас очень много строк, которые нужно вставить в таблицу, то можно воспользоваться JavaScript, чтобы автоматизировать этот процесс. Примеры кода и методы для вставки множества строк с помощью JavaScript можно найти в документации и учебных ресурсах по этому языку программирования.
Выводя итог, существуют различные способы эффективно добавить много строк в таблицу одновременно. Используя теги <ul> и <li>, <ol> и <li> или JavaScript, вы можете значительно ускорить и упростить процесс вставки множества строк в таблицу.
Использовать функцию insertAdjacentHTML
Если вам необходимо сразу добавить много строк в таблицу, вы можете воспользоваться функцией insertAdjacentHTML. Эта функция позволяет вставить HTML-код в определенное место контента элемента.
Для вставки строк в таблицу существует несколько вариантов расположения кода. Ниже приведены примеры наиболее часто используемых вариантов:
1. Вставить строки в начало таблицы
const table = document.querySelector( table ); const html = `
<tr>
<td>Апельсин</td>
<td>Фрукт</td>
</tr>
<tr>
<td>Арбуз</td>
<td>Ягода</td>
</tr>
`;
table.insertAdjacentHTML( afterbegin , html);
2. Вставить строки в конец таблицы
const table = document.querySelector( table ); const html = `
<tr>
<td>Морковь</td>
<td>Овощ</td>
</tr>
<tr>
<td>Огурец</td>
<td>Овощ</td>
</tr>
`;
table.insertAdjacentHTML( beforeend , html);
3. Вставить строки после определенного элемента
const table = document.querySelector( table ); const markerRow = document.querySelector( .marker-row );
const html = `
<tr>
<td>Груша</td>
<td>Фрукт</td>
</tr>
<tr>
<td>Персик</td>
<td>Фрукт</td>
</tr>
`;
markerRow.insertAdjacentHTML( afterend , html);
В каждом из примеров выше мы используем шаблонный литерал для создания строк HTML-кода. В функцию insertAdjacentHTML передается первым параметром строка, указывающая, где точно нужно вставить HTML-код. Вторым параметром передается сам HTML-код, который нужно вставить.
Используя функцию insertAdjacentHTML, вы можете быстро и легко добавить много строк в таблицу точно в нужное место.
На нашем сайте вы найдете множество советов по ремонту и обслуживанию мобильных телефонов
Как вставить новую строку в конце таблицы
Иногда возникает необходимость добавить новую строку в самом конце таблицы. И если добавлять ее описанным выше способом, она не попадет в саму таблицу, а окажется вне ее рамок.
Примечание: Этот способ подойдет, только когда нижняя строка не используется как строка “Итого” и не суммирует все предыдущие.
Если необходимо вставить определенное количество строк один раз, то Интервал необходимо выставить – 0, Количество вставок – 1.
Как вставить новую строку в конце таблицы
Иногда возникает необходимость добавить новую строку в самом конце таблицы. И если добавлять ее описанным выше способом, она не попадет в саму таблицу, а окажется вне ее рамок.
- Для начала мы выделяем всю последнюю строку таблицы, щелкнув левой кнопкой мыши по ее номеру. Затем наводим курсор на нижний правый угол строки, пока он не изменит свою форму на “крестик”.
Примечание: Этот способ подойдет, только когда нижняя строка не используется как строка “Итого” и не суммирует все предыдущие.
Вставка нескольких столбцов между столбцами одновременно
В нашем прайсе все еще не достает двух столбцов: количество и единицы измерения (шт. кг. л. упак.). Чтобы одновременно добавить два столбца, выделите диапазон из двух ячеек C1:D1. Далее используйте тот же инструмент на главной закладке «Вставить»-«Вставить столбцы на лист».
Или выделите два заголовка столбца C и D, щелкните правой кнопкой мышки и выберите опцию «Вставить».
Примечание. Столбцы всегда добавляются в левую сторону. Количество новых колонок появляется столько, сколько было их предварительно выделено. Порядок столбцов вставки, так же зависит от порядка их выделения. Например, через одну и т.п.
Предположим, что имеется таблица с перечнем рабочих специальностей: сантехники, электрики и слесари КиП работающих на заводе имени Красного Стахановца.
Вставка сразу нескольких строк с помощью INSERT INTO
Если нам нужно вставить несколько строк, то мы просто перечисляем группы значений через запятую выглядит это так:
Допустим у нас есть еще одна таблица table2 которая по структуре точно такая же как и первая. Нам в таблицу table2 нужно вставить все строки из table1.
Вам следует позаботиться об уникальности ключей, если они есть в таблице, в которую мы вставляем. Например при дублировании PRIMARY KEY мы получим следующее сообщение об ошибке:
Если вы делаете не какую-то единичную вставку при переносе данных, а где-то сохраните этот запрос, например в вашем PHP скрипте, то всегда перечисляйте столбцы.
Если у вас со временем изменится количество столбцов в таблице, то запрос перестанет работать. При выполнении запроса MySQL в лучшем случае просто будет возвращать ошибку:
А теперь представим, что нам нужно вставить только те строки из table1, у которых столбец «c» равен 333. Тогда наш запрос будет выглядеть так
То есть мы просто вставляем данные в таблицу, которые выбрали из другой таблицы при помощи обычного SELECT запроса
Теперь представим, что у нас в таблице table2 — 4 столбца, а в table1 — 3. При этом четвертый столбец в table2 обязательный. Чтобы выйти из этой ситуации, нужно передать какое-нибудь подходящее значение в этот лишний столбец. У нас чисто абстрактная задача, поэтому давайте передадим туда просто единицу.
Допустим у нас есть прайс, в котором недостает нумерации позиций:
Простой запрос, который вставляет строку со столбцами 111, 222 и 333 выглядит так:
Столбцы, которые вы не перечислите заполняются значениями по умолчанию, которые вы предусматриваете при создании таблицы, даже если это просто NULL.
У таблиц обычно есть поле id с первичным ключом (PRIMARY KEY) таблицы. Если этому полю установлено значение AUTOINCREMENT т.е. оно заполняется автоматически, то в таком случае вы не должны его перечислять в списке столбцов оператора INSERT.
Как в Excel вставить столбец между столбцами?
Допустим у нас есть прайс, в котором недостает нумерации позиций:
Чтобы вставить столбец между столбцами для заполнения номеров позиций прайс-листа, можно воспользоваться одним из двух способов:
Как вставить новую строку в конце “умной” таблицы
Есть три способа, как добавить новую строку в конце «умной” таблицы.
Примечание: если будут указаны параметры, в результате выполнения которых количество строк превысит максимально возможное количество для добавления (например если указать Добавлять по 100000; Интервал 5; Начать вставку с 8; Количество вставок 11), появится такое окно:
Добавление нескольких пустых строк в таблицу Excel
Для того, чтобы вставить несколько новых строк в документ, необходимо выделить строку, выше которой нужно добавить новые строки, и не отпуская левой кнопки мыши выделить столько строк, сколько нужно вставить.
После того как строки выделены, необходимо щелкнуть правой кнопкой мыши на выделенном участке листа и из контекстного меню выбрать пункт «Вставить», либо воспользоваться кнопками во вкладках ленты, аналогично тому, как это описано в предыдущем пункте.
Как вставить новую строку в конце “умной” таблицы
Есть три способа, как добавить новую строку в конце «умной” таблицы.
В этот раз новые ячейки не станут автозаполняться исходными данными (за исключением формул). Следовательно, нам не нужно удалять их содержимое, что очень удобно.
- Можно просто начать вводить данные в строке сразу под таблицей, и она автоматически станет частью нашей “умной” таблицы.
Новая строка добавится автоматически с учетом всех параметров форматирования таблицы.
Вставляем пустые строки в таблицу эксель через одну
Кстати, удалить вставленные неправильные строки тоже очень просто. Так же выделяем строку полностью, (поставив курсор на ее номер) и вызываем контекстное меню, удаляем.
Можно отменить предыдущее действие, нажав сочетание клавишь CTRL +z. В нашем примере строки таблицы залиты другим цветом. Чтобы в эти места добавить новые строки просто выделим их номера при нажатой клавише Ctrl:
В моем примере появилось три новых строки; только необходимо учитывать что выделенные строки съезжают вниз, а новые будут находиться выше их. На этом у меня все! Удачи!
Способ 3: создание «умной» таблицы
Чтобы работать с таблицей стало еще проще, необходимо осуществить группировку строк в Excel. Другими словами, создать «умную» таблицу. Это позволит не прибегать ко всевозможным ухищрениям, о которых было рассказано в предыдущем способе. Делается это просто:
Читайте также: Как обновить браузеры на компьютере: Google Chrome, Яндекс, Opera, Mozilla Firefox, IE
Сразу после этого будет создана «умная» таблица. Теперь добавить новые строки можно в ней как в конце, так и в середине. Это был третий способ, как в Excel добавить строки, он же последний.
Если количество значений, которые мы вставляем = количеству столбцов в таблице, то можно не перечислять столбцы, и наш запрос может выглядеть так:
Полезные приложения Настраиваем устройства Выбираем iphone Нюансы подключения Windows 10 и 11 Выгодные тарифы Пропадает интернет Отключение подписки Пошаговые видеоинструкции


